在Asp.net MVC的Controller中返回类型JsonResult方法中需要跳转到其他Action时怎么弄?
代码大致如下publicJsonResultExchange(objectobj){if(obj!=null){returnJson(obj);}else{returnR...
代码大致如下
public JsonResult Exchange(object obj)
{
if(obj != null)
{
return Json(obj);
}
else
{
return RedirectToAction("Error");
}
}
错误 1 无法将类型“System.Web.Mvc.RedirectToRouteResult”隐式转换为“System.Web.Mvc.JsonResult”
我现在这样做,是这样提示的
求破 展开
public JsonResult Exchange(object obj)
{
if(obj != null)
{
return Json(obj);
}
else
{
return RedirectToAction("Error");
}
}
错误 1 无法将类型“System.Web.Mvc.RedirectToRouteResult”隐式转换为“System.Web.Mvc.JsonResult”
我现在这样做,是这样提示的
求破 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询